Mental Health Programs For Adolescents

Mental health programs for adolescents are designed to provide support and resources to help young people navigate mental health challenges such as anxiety, depression, and stress.

Key Features

  • Therapeutic interventions
  • Education on mental health
  • Support groups
  • Crisis intervention services

Pros

  • Helps adolescents develop coping skills
  • Promotes emotional well-being
  • Provides a safe space for discussing mental health issues

Cons

  • Access to programs may be limited in some areas
  • Stigma surrounding mental health may prevent some adolescents from seeking help
